You drop a ball from a stair case that is 36 ft high. By the time you get down the stairs to measure the height of the bounce, the ball has bounced four times and has a height of 2.25 ft after its fourth bounce. How high did the ball bounce after it first hit the floor?
Answer:
18 feet
Step-by-step explanation:
After each bounce, the ball reaches only a percentage of the maximum height it reached before.
The first height is 36 feet, after the first bounce, it will be 36*r, where r is the ratio of the height the ball can still reach by the previous maximum height.
In the second bounce, the height is 36*r^2
In the third bounce, the height is 36*r^3
In the fourth bounce, the height is 36*r^4, and this value is 2.25 ft, so:
36*r^4 = 2.25
r^4 = 2.25/36
r^4 = 0.0625
r = 0.5
So, after the first bounce, the height is:
36*r = 36*0.5 = 18 feet
The height should be 18 feet.

Answer: No, those measurements cannot make a triangle
Why not? Because of the fact that the first two sides (5 and 9) add to 5+9 = 14, which is exactly as long as the third side. I recommend you using a ruler to measure out 5 inches, 9 inches and 14 inches. Mark all three as separate segments on a piece of paper. Then cut out those segments to form strips of paper with the given lengths. Then try to form a triangle. You'll find that it is impossible since the smaller segments combine perfectly to get the longest segment. Instead of a triangle, you'll only have a line segment forming.
As a rule, when you add any two sides of a triangle, they must add to something larger than the third side. The rule more formally is
For any triangle with sides a,b,c, the following three inequalities must hold true

The maximum value of y in the equation y = -x2 + 6x – 8 is y=
Answer:
1
Step-by-step explanation:
A graph shows you very quickly that the maximum value of y is 1.
__
There are several ways to get there algebraically. The axis of symmetry is given for ax^2 +bx by x=-b/(2a). Here, that value is x=(-6)/(2(-1)) = 3. The maximum y-value will correspond to this x-value:
y = -3² +6·3 -8 = -9 +18 -8 = 1
The maximum value of y is 1.
__
The axis of symmetry can also be found by factoring:
y = -(x -4)(x -2)
It is halfway between the values of x that make these factors zero, so is ...
x=(4+2)/2 = 3
For that value of x, we find y to be ...
y = -(3 -4)(3 -2) = 1
__
We can also rearrange the equation to vertex form:
y = -(x^2 -6x) -8
= -(x^2 -6x +9) -8 -(-9)
= -(x -3)^2 +1
The vertex is (3, 1), so the maximum value of y is 1.

A support wire is tied diagonally from the middle of a tree to a stake on the ground. The length of the wire is 10 ft and the angle of
elevation from the stake is 55". Approximately how high on the tree is the connection point of the wire?
Answer:
8.2 ft
.Step-by-step explanation:
Sketch this situation. Label the 55° angle. The adjacent side is the distance from the stake to the bottom center of the tree. The opposite side is the distance from the ground to the connection point of the wire on the tree. The wire length represents the hypotenuse of this triangle. We want to find the length of the side opposite the 55° angle. Thus, we write
sin 55° = (opposite side)/(hypotenuse), or
(hypotenuse)(sin 55°) = (10 ft)(0.819) = 8.2 ft
Using trigonometry and the sine function, we can calculate the height of the tree as 10 ft * sin(55), which equals approximately 8.19 ft.
Explanation:This problem can be solved using trigonometry, specifically the sine function. In a right triangle, the sine of an angle is defined as the length of the opposite side divided by the length of the hypotenuse. In this case, the tree forms the opposite side of our triangle, the support wire forms the hypotenuse and the angle of elevation is 55 degrees.
To express this mathematically, we can write: sin(55) = height / 10 ft. Solving this equation for height gives us: height = 10 ft * sin(55). Using a calculator, we find that sin(55) is approximately 0.81915, so the height is around 8.19 ft. Therefore, the connection point of the wire to the tree is at approximately 8.19 ft high.
